Transaction 59ac0500ecd2080b39c46b9eccc85fa5233d448a9ded26d526a81f24dc0a7611

1 Input
2 Outputs
  • 59ac0500ecd2080b39c46b9eccc85fa5233d448a9ded26d526a81f24dc0a7611:0
  • value  2965150
    address  1FuAFY2pWkWd7ByUfSpZ6tDCuqurN77yrk
  • 59ac0500ecd2080b39c46b9eccc85fa5233d448a9ded26d526a81f24dc0a7611:1
  • value  1444542585
    address  3LFSPN9Xrot98GY5HbEQuK4a5N5U7xYR4Q